#include "pw_unit_test/googletest_test_matchers.h"
#include <cstdlib>
#include "pw_status/status.h"
namespace pw::unit_test {
namespace {
TEST(TestMatchers, AssertOk) { ASSERT_OK(OkStatus()); }
TEST(TestMatchers, AssertOkStatusWithSize) { ASSERT_OK(StatusWithSize(123)); }
TEST(TestMatchers, AssertOkResult) { ASSERT_OK(Result<int>(123)); }
TEST(TestMatchers, ExpectOk) { EXPECT_OK(OkStatus()); }
TEST(TestMatchers, ExpectOkStatusWithSize) { EXPECT_OK(StatusWithSize(123)); }
TEST(TestMatchers, ExpectOkResult) { EXPECT_OK(Result<int>(123)); }

// The following test is commented out and is only for checking what
// failure cases would look like. For example, when uncommenting the test,
// the output is:
//
// ERR pw_unit_test/googletest_test_matchers_test.cc:50: Failure
// ERR Expected:
// ERR Actual: Value of: OkStatus()
// Expected: has status UNKNOWN
// Actual: 4-byte object <00-00 00-00>, which has status OK
// ERR pw_unit_test/googletest_test_matchers_test.cc:51: Failure
// ERR Expected:
// ERR Actual: Value of: Status::Unknown()
// Expected: is OK
// Actual: 4-byte object <02-00 00-00>, which has status UNKNOWN
// ERR pw_unit_test/googletest_test_matchers_test.cc:52: Failure
// ERR Expected:
// ERR Actual: Value of: Status::Unknown()
// Expected: is OK
// Actual: 4-byte object <02-00 00-00>, which has status UNKNOWN
//
// TEST(TestMatchers, SampleFailures) {
// EXPECT_THAT(OkStatus(), StatusIs(Status::Unknown()));
// EXPECT_OK(Status::Unknown());
// ASSERT_OK(Status::Unknown());
// }
